About this listen

Murder and family secrets, a touch of romance and deeply-felt revenge with the twist of all twists make up the perfect audiobook, One Good Deed, from one of the world's bestselling thriller writers, David Baldacci.

'One of his finest books. Great character, great story, great portrait of an era' – Bill Clinton

Freedom never tasted so sweet

Poca City 1949. Fresh from serving time for a crime he didn’t commit, Aloysius Archer is ready to put the past behind him and start again.

Who can you trust?

Accepting a job as a debt collector for the local tycoon he gets embroiled in a long-running feud between
the town’s most dangerous residents. When one of them is found dead, Archer is the number one suspect.

Framed for murder

A bloody game is being played in this town. Should Archer run or fight for the truth?
